The Role of Temperature-Controlled Logistics in Supply Chains 

From production to delivery, Temperature-Controlled Logistics ensures that products maintain their required temperature range, reducing waste and optimizing transit times. Using state-of-the-art technology and trained personnel, this specialized logistics model minimizes disruptions and ensures timely delivery. 

Key Applications Across Industries 

Temperature-Controlled Logistics supports critical sectors such as: 

  • Pharmaceuticals 



  • Food and Beverage 



  • Biotechnology 



  • Fine Arts and Electronics 


Each of these industries relies heavily on maintaining strict temperature ranges to preserve product integrity and meet customer expectations.
